AUSTRALIAN POLITICS

IMPERIAL GOVERNMENT C-RITI- .. . CiSKD. Australian and N.Z. Cable 'Association Melbourne, Fobraury 10. In the Senate, -Senator Henderson gave notice of motion that a petition be presented to the King expressing the hops that a measure of Home Rule would be granted to Ireland. Senator Ferricks criticised the Imperial Governments war policy and deprecated secret diplomacy and negotiation. The diplomatic service was run as an asylum for the sons of the rich.
